Fire damage restoration is the process of repairing and rebuilding a property after a fire. It involves cleaning soot and smoke, removing water damage, fixing structural issues, and restoring the property to its pre-fire condition. Our aim is to make your home safe and livable again.
In Virginia, remediation often covers the initial emergency steps, like water extraction or securing the property. Restoration is the subsequent phase where we repair and rebuild your property. This returns it to its original condition. We handle both for a complete recovery.
